Egypt .. Warning from Saturdays, Sundays and Mondays due to the "Sudan depression"

The Egyptian Meteorological Authority revealed that the country is affected by the extension of the Sudan depression, which is working to raise temperatures to prevail in a very hot atmosphere as of tomorrow.

This wave will continue over the next week, to be the peak of the rise on Sunday and Monday, according to the seventh day.

Today, hot weather prevails in Greater Cairo, and the sea face is very hot in southern Egypt, tending to heat on the northern coasts, and Greater Cairo today records 35 degrees Celsius.

On Saturday, the Meteorological Authority expects that temperatures will continue to rise, with very hot weather prevailing during the day in Greater Cairo, Lower Egypt, southern Egypt, hot on the northern coasts and South Sinai, gentle at night in the north of the country until Greater Cairo, moderate over southern Sinai and the south of the country.
